DTC P0325: Knock Sensor
NOTE:
Freeze frame data will not be stored in the ECM for the knock sensor. The MIL will not light for a knock sensor malfunction.
- Check Input Signal Circuit - Loosen and retighten engine ground screws. See Figure. Turn ignition switch to OFF position. Disconnect ECM harness connector and knock sensor sub-harness connector. See Figure and Fig 1 . Using an ohmmeter, check continuity between knock sensor sub-harness connector terminal No. 5 and ECM harness connector terminal No. 54 (White wire). See Figure and Fig 2 . If no continuity exists, repair open in White wire. If continuity exists, go to next step.
- Check Component - With ambient temperature about 77°F (25°C), measure resistance between KS terminal (White wire) and ground. Resistance should be 500-620 k/ohms. If resistance is as specified, go to next step. If resistance is not as specified, replace KS. See KNOCK SENSOR .
- Disconnect ECM wiring harness connector. Check connector pins for damage or corrosion. Check all circuit connectors for clean, tight fit and service if necessary. Loosen and retighten engine ground screws (located on intake manifold collector). If fault is still present, replace sensor. See KNOCK SENSOR .
